‘Galaxy’ by World of Women (WoW) NFT got sold out in 3 days

On Saturday, World of Women launched its second non-fungible token collection – The World of Women (WoW) Galaxy. The new collection got completely sold out within three days generating $79 million worth of revenue. According to CryptoSlam, within 24 hours of the availability of collection, the initial mint sale was $34 million.
